Electrical/Domestic Tester

Main duties and responsibilities for an Electrical/Domestic Tester

As an Electrical/Domestic Tester you will report to the Supervisor / Contract Manager, and you are the first point of contact between the business and our client. You must have good written and oral communication skills and have a high level of technical knowledge across the electrical industry.

Working hours are Monday-Friday 08.00-17.00 with weekend work and overtime available upon request!

The main duties of an Electrical/Domestic Tester include:

  • Conduct EICR testing and inspections to ensure all electrical installations comply with current regulations.
  • Perform routine electrical testing and maintenance on housing association properties.
  • Diagnose and repair electrical faults in a timely and efficient manner.
  • Install, maintain, and repair electrical systems.
  • Diagnose and repair electrical faults in a timely and efficient manner.
  • Ensure all work is completed to a high standard and in compliance with health and safety regulations.
  • Complete EICR certifications and accurate records of all inspections, tests, and repairs.
  • Provide excellent and friendly customer service to tenants and address any electrical concerns promptly.

Qualifications:

  • NVQ Level 3 in Electrical Installation or equivalent.
  • City & Guilds 2391 or 2394/2395 in Inspection and Testing.
  • 18th Edition
  • Proven experience in EICR testing and electrical testing.
